Citrine

Citrine is a programming language developed within the OpenCog framework, an open-source artificial general intelligence (AGI) project. It offers a high-level interface for building and manipulating complex knowledge structures, incorporating probabilistic logic and evolutionary learning algorithms to enable AI agents to reason with uncertainty and adapt their behavior over time through experience. This enables the creation of advanced AGI systems capable of simulating human-like cognitive processes in various areas such as perception, decision-making under uncertainty, and hierarchical goal-setting in dynamic environments.

The developers behind Citrine are researchers and contributors to the OpenCog community who have focused on advancing AGI systems by implementing features that support sophisticated cognitive architectures. The language was designed within the OpenCog framework for seamless integration with other system components like AtomSpace or Probabilistic Logic Networks (PLN). This integration contributes to the comprehensive nature of intelligent systems developed within this AGI project by enabling the combination of different cognitive functionalities effectively.

Citrine's unique incorporation of probabilistic logic and evolutionary learning algorithms allows AI agents to handle uncertainty and adapt behavior based on experience.
